江南大学网络教育c语言程序设计,2017江南大学程序设计C语言期末试卷附答案

62e50291a81fc54b507f33cb80033297.gif 2017江南大学程序设计C语言期末试卷附答案

(13页)

61d852ea46fa621fcd22eba2ef94f456.gif

本资源提供全文预览,点击全文预览即可全文预览,如果喜欢文档就下载吧,查找使用更方便哦!

14.9 积分

江南大学考《程序设计(C语言)》期末考试卷 (A)本题 得分-、选择题K每题2分,共计40分』使用专业、班级 学号 姓名 题数—?二三四五总 分得分1. 下列变量合法的是(B ) oA. 2a0 B-」a0 C- x>y D. b-a2. 假设所有变量均为整型,贝9表达式(a=2,b=5,b++,a+b^值是(B )。A. 7 B. 8 C? 6 D? 23. 有以下程序:void main(){int x=101,y=011;printf("%2d,%2d\n",x,y);}执行后输出结果是(C ) oA. 10,9 B. 101,11 C? 101,9 D. 01,114. 若有说明语句:char c='\7T;则变量c ( A )。A.包含1个字符 B.包含2个字符C?包含3个字符D.说明不合法,c的值不确定5?阅读一下程序,当输入数据的形式为25, 13, 10正确的输出结果为 (D ) ovoid main(){int x,y,z;scanf(n%d%d%dn,&x,&y,&z); printf(” x+y+z=%d\n”,x+y+z);C. x+z二35D.不确定值}A. x+y+z二48 B. x+y+z二35考试形式开卷()、闭卷(V),在选项上打(J )开课教研室 命题教师统一命题时问 使用学期 6. 定义如下变量和数组:int k;int a ⑶[3]={ 123,4,5,6,7,8,9}; 则下面语句的输出结果为( )。for(k=0;k<3;k++) printf(”%d”,a[k][2?k]);A. 3 5 7 B. 3 69 C. 1 5 97. 有以下程序:void main(){ int i,n=0;for(i=2;i<5;i++){ do{ if(i%3) continue;n++;} while(!i);n++;}printf(un=%d\nn,n);}程序执行后的输出结果是( )。A. n=5 B. n=2 C. n=3D. 147D. n=48. 已知字母A的ASCII码为十进制数65,且c2为字符型,则执行语句c2"A屮6=3;后c2中的值为( )。A. D B. 68 C?不确定的值 D. C9. putchar函数可以向终端输出一个( )。A.整型变量表达式值 B.实型变量值C.字符串 D.字符或字符型变量值10. C语言中while和do-while循环的主要区别是( )。A. do-while循环是表达式不成立才进入循环体B. do-while的循环控制条件至少无条件执行一次C. do-while允许从外部转到循环体内,而while循环不允许D. do-while的循环体不能是复合语句11. 设x, y和z是int型变量,且x二3, y二4, z二5,则下面表达式中值为0的是( )OA. 'x&&'y‘B? x<=yC? x||y+z&&y?zD. !((x=0);19?设x为int型变量,则执行以下语句后, x=10; x+=x-=x-x;A?10 B?2020?下面程序段的运行结果是(B. i=10;while(l){ i=i%10+l;if(i>10) break; }D. i=100;while什+i%2) i++x的值为(C?40)oD. 30char a[7]=z,cibcdefz,;char b[4]二〃ABC";strcpy(a,b); printf("%c〃, a[5]); A.空格B. \0C. eD. f本题 得分二、判断题K每题1分,共计io分》( )1. 一个函数利用return只能返回一个函数值。()2.在程序运行过程中,系统分配给实参和形参的内存单元是不同的。( )3.用scanf输入字符时,字符串中不能包含空格。( )4. Continue和break都可用来实现循环体的中止。()5.字符常量的长度肯定为1。()6.在对某一函数进行多次调用时,系统会对相应的自动变量重新分配存储单元。()7?在C语言的复合语句屮,只能包含可执行语句。()8.在复合语句内部定义 关 键 词: 2017 江南 大学 程序设计 语言 期末试卷 答案

524d6daf746efaa52c3c71bbfe7ba172.gif  天天文库所有资源均是用户自行上传分享,仅供网友学习交流,未经上传用户书面授权,请勿作他用。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值